Description: Intelligent automation refers to the use of advanced technologies such as artificial intelligence (AI), machine learning, and data analytics to automate processes and improve efficiency across various industries. This practice enables organizations to optimize their operations, reduce costs, and minimize human errors. Intelligent automation combines traditional automation, which relies on predefined rules, with the ability to learn and adapt to new situations, making it more flexible and effective. Through the implementation of tools like configuration as code, companies can manage and deploy infrastructures more agilely and consistently, facilitating system integration and scalability. In a world where speed and accuracy are crucial, intelligent automation has become an essential component of digital transformation, allowing organizations not only to survive but to thrive in a competitive environment.
History: Intelligent automation has evolved over the past few decades, starting with basic automation in industry during the Industrial Revolution. With the advancement of computing in the 1960s and 1970s, more sophisticated control systems were introduced. However, the real push towards intelligent automation began in the 2010s with the rise of artificial intelligence and machine learning, which allowed machines to learn from data and improve their performance. Companies like IBM and Google have been pioneers in this field, developing technologies that integrate AI into automated processes.
Uses: Intelligent automation is used in various areas, including manufacturing, customer service, human resources management, and cybersecurity. In manufacturing, it is employed to optimize production lines and reduce downtime. In customer service, AI-powered chatbots can handle common inquiries, freeing human agents for more complex tasks. In human resources, it is used to automate recruitment and talent management processes. In cybersecurity, it helps detect and respond to threats in real-time.
Examples: An example of intelligent automation is the use of collaborative robots in factories, which work alongside humans to enhance efficiency. Another case is the use of marketing automation platforms that analyze customer data to personalize advertising campaigns. In customer service, companies like Amazon use chatbots to manage inquiries and orders, improving the user experience.
